US to pull out of Paris agreement January 2026

The United States has officially notified the secretary-general of its withdrawal from the Paris Climate Agreement, effective January 27, 2026. UN spokesperson, Stéphane Dujarric announced this at a news briefing in New York. Teenager, two others killed in Lagos building collapse

The Lagos State Emergency Management Agency today, confirmed the death of a teenager alongside two other males in the building collapse at Northern Vulture Estate, Chevron Drive. Ferdinand urges United to sign Osimhen

Manchester United legend Rio Ferdinand has urged the Red Devils to sign Nigeria striker Victor Osimhen to help struggling forward Rasmus Hojlund. Probe begins as gunmen abduct Abuja family of four

The Federal Capital Territory Police Command has launched an investigation into the abduction of a family of four at the Chikakore community in the Bwari Area Council.
